Breaking Down the Features of Safariland 7354 ALS Tactical Holster, Heckler & – 1 out of 36 models
Specifications
Firearm Compatibility: Specifically molded for the H&K USP 9mm/.40 Compact with a 3.58-inch barrel. This ensures a snug and secure fit, preventing unwanted movement during active use.
Retention System: Features Safariland’s Automatic Locking System (ALS). The ALS locks the weapon in place upon holstering and is released with a simple thumb swipe, offering excellent security without sacrificing draw speed.
Material: Constructed from Safariland’s proprietary 7TS material. This material is incredibly durable, resistant to heat, cold, and impact, and will not mar the firearm’s finish.
Finish: Available in a plain black finish. The non-reflective finish is ideal for tactical applications where minimizing visibility is crucial.
Hand Orientation: Right-hand configuration. Ensures that the holster is designed specifically for right-handed users, providing optimal draw speed and accessibility.
Mounting Options: Designed to be mounted on various Safariland mounting platforms, including belt loops, drop legs, and MOLLE attachments. This provides versatility in how the holster is carried, allowing users to customize their setup to their specific needs.

The Safariland 7354 ALS Tactical Holster is perfect for law enforcement officers, military personnel, security professionals, and anyone who requires a secure, reliable, and fast-drawing holster for their H&K USP Compact. It’s also well-suited for competitive shooters who demand a high-performance holster that can withstand the rigors of competition.
This product may not be ideal for casual concealed carry, as it is designed primarily for open carry and tactical applications. Individuals who are new to firearms or who prefer simpler holster designs may also find the ALS system to be unnecessary or complicated.
A must-have accessory is a compatible Safariland mounting platform, such as a belt loop or drop leg platform. A quality gun belt is also essential for comfortable and secure carry.
